How Much Should I Feed My Dog? A Complete Guide

Feeding guidelines based on your dog's weight, age, and activity level.

Every dog is different, but here are some guidelines to help you find the right amount for your four-legged friend.

Adult Dogs (Maintenance)

  • 1-4 kg: 50-70g per day
  • 5-10 kg: 100-150g per day
  • 11-20 kg: 150-220g per day
  • 21-30 kg: 220-300g per day
  • 31-40 kg: 300-380g per day

Puppies Need More

Growing puppies need roughly 50% more food than adult dogs of the same weight. Split their daily amount into 3-4 meals until they're about 6 months old, then transition to twice daily.

Remember: these are guidelines. Adjust based on your dog's body condition – you should be able to feel their ribs but not see them prominently.
